• ベストアンサー

C言語のコンパイル方法

先程、「独習C」を使って勉強していると質問した者です。 私のDOS窓は今 C:\TYC4TH>gcc test.c -o test.exe gcc: test.c: No such file or directory gcc: no input files となっています。 どうすれば、プログラムが実行できますか?

質問者が選んだベストアンサー

  • ベストアンサー
  • Boo-king
  • ベストアンサー率19% (5/26)
回答No.1

実行以前にコンパイルができていません。 test.c が見つからないと言っています。 C:\TYC4TH>dir を入力してみると、おそらく test.cは表示されないはずです。 コンパイラは、test.cがどこにあるかが判らないのです。 そこで、単純な解決さくとしては、 test.cというCファイルを C:\TYC4TH にコピーするか コマンドを C:\TYC4TH>gcc C:\dummy\path\test.c -o test.exe といった具合に絶対パスで指定してあげてください。 そうすればコンパイルができるはずです。

その他の回答 (1)

  • Boo-king
  • ベストアンサー率19% (5/26)
回答No.2

#1で回答したものです。 先ほどの絶対パス部分は例です。 そのままでは動きませんので、実際にtest.cがあるPathを指定してください。

noname#62377
質問者

お礼

コンパイルできました。 丁寧にありがとうございました。

関連するQ&A